What is PluginMart.dll?

PluginMart.dll is usually located in the 'c:\users\%USERNAME%\appdata\local\plugin mart\xbin\' folder.

Some of the anti-virus scanners at VirusTotal detected PluginMart.dll.

VirusTotal report

28 of the 54 anti-virus programs at VirusTotal detected the PluginMart.dll file. That's a 52% detection rate.
